ccjersey - 9/9/2024 22:14

How much fuel is in it? The entire fuel system can be below the level of the fuel or it can be above the fuel. Makes a big difference.


+1.

Fill your fuel tank completely full, and then let it sit for 2 weeks or whatever you were doing before. Thoroughly check for any fuel leaks, and recheck your fuel level to confirm it's still full.

With the tank full, the fuel level will be above the entire fuel/filter system. If no leaks, and a full tank after sitting, and it's still hard to start, it's not from fuel draining back.
